Fodera Foods

Fodera Foods, a prominent player in the food industry, is headquartered in the United States and operates across various regions, focusing on delivering high-quality culinary products. Founded in 2015, the company has quickly established itself as a leader in the gourmet food sector, specialising in artisanal sauces and condiments that elevate everyday meals. What sets Fodera Foods apart is its commitment to using premium, locally sourced ingredients, ensuring that each product is not only delicious but also supports sustainable practices. With a growing portfolio that includes unique flavour profiles and innovative recipes, Fodera Foods has garnered a loyal customer base and received accolades for its exceptional quality. As the company continues to expand its market presence, it remains dedicated to redefining the culinary experience for food enthusiasts across the nation.

Fodera Foods's reported carbon emissions

Fodera Foods, headquartered in the US, currently does not have publicly available carbon emissions data for the most recent year. As such, specific figures regarding their Scope 1, 2, or 3 emissions are not provided. Additionally, there are no documented reduction targets or climate pledges outlined in their initiatives. In the absence of concrete emissions data, it is essential to note that many companies in the food industry are increasingly focusing on sustainability and climate commitments. This often includes setting science-based targets for emissions reductions and engaging in initiatives aimed at minimising their carbon footprint. Fodera Foods may be participating in similar industry trends, but specific details on their commitments or targets are not available at this time.
